## 3. Ride the Connector!
**Date: September 20, 9:30 AM – 1:00 PM**

Celebrate the opening of phase 3 of the Redmond Central Connector of Eastrail with a casual bike ride. Meet at the Marymoor Village Station for a scenic 6-mile ride along mostly paved trails, ending at Totem Lake in Kirkland. This event is suitable for all ages and abilities.
